Cardinals Drop Road Contest to No. 17 Vanderbilt
August 17, 2025 | Women's Soccer
Louisville went 1-1 in its opening road trip of the season
NASHVILLE, Tenn. — The Louisville women's soccer team dropped the final game of its road trip, 2-0, to No. 17 Vanderbilt Sunday night at the Vanderbilt Soccer Complex. Vanderbilt scored twice in the opening 20 minutes and the Cardinals were unable to break through on the score sheet.
The Cardinals had a good chance to open the scoring in the 11th minute. Amelia Swinarski had a good run into the box for the chance. She cut back to beat her defender and sent a pass back towards the middle of the box but could not connect with any of the oncoming attackers.
Vanderbilt jumped in front in the 13th minute after a long pass up from Mary Beth McLaughlin. She found a streaking Olivia Stafford behind the Louisville defense and she tucked a shot into the back of the net to give the Commodores a 1-0 lead.
Vanderbilt doubled its lead in the 19th minute after Courtney Jones converted from the spot to put the Dores up 2-0.
Erynn Floyd made some key saves in the first half to keep the Cards in striking distance but they trailed 2-0 at the break.
The Cardinals had a chance in the 52nd when Lizzie Sexton got fouled heading into the box. After a review, it was determined the foul occurred just outside the box and it gave Louisville a free kick in a dangerous area. The service into the box got headed around but the Commodores eventually cleared it out of danger.
Vanderbilt turned the ball over at midfield in the 77th minute and it led to a chance when Emersen Jennings got in behind the Commodores defense. She was 1-v-1 with the keeper but her shot ended high of the net and out of play.
Up next for the Cardinals is a six-game homestand that kicks off on Thursday, August 21. It will be a doubleheader as the men's team will take on Southern Indiana at 5 p.m. before the women take on Detroit at approximately 7:30 p.m. ET from Dr. Mark & Cindy Lynn Stadium. Both matches will be streamed on the ACC Network Extra and admission is free.
